Friedman Named President of HRM Health Plans (PA), Inc.PHILADELPHIA, March 19 /PRNewswire/ --HRM Health Plans (PA), Inc., (HRM PA), a Philadelphia-based subsidiary of Health Risk Management, Inc. (Nasdaq: HRMI), announced today that William R. Friedman has assumed the position of president. HRM PA owns and operates Pennsylvania HealthMATE, a health plan providing services to Medicaid recipients in central and northeastern Pennsylvania; and OakTree Health Plan, an HMO HMO health maintenance organization. "I am pleased to be joining HRM PA," Friedman said, "and I look forward to working with our members, physicians, hospitals, clinics, community organizations and state officials involved with OakTree Health Plan in the greater Philadelphia area and the HealthMATE plan in the greater Harrisburg area." Friedman comes to HRM PA from his prior position as vice president of managed care at Robert Wood Johnson Health System, New Brunswick, N.J. There he was responsible for managed care operations and relationship building within an integrated health care integrated health care, n healthcare services combining the best of conventional and complementary health care. system consisting of eight hospitals, four community health centers, a medical school and physician groups. From 1993 to 1996 he was executive director of health services with Aetna Health Plans of New Jersey in Parsippany where he managed health services, operations, cost reduction efforts and strategic development for the 300,000-member organization. Additional leadership positions include president and CEO of Palisades Medical Center, North Bergen, N.J., from 1989 to 1993; chief financial officer at Palisades from 1985-1989; assistant executive director of fiscal affairs at Mercy Hospital, Pittsburgh, from 1983-1985; and chief financial officer at Irvington General Hospital in Irvington N.J. from 1980 to 1983. Friedman succeeds Thomas Clark, executive vice president of Business Development at Minneapolis-based HRM, who was named acting president of HRM PA late last year during the search for a president; Clark will aid in the transition. HRM, based in Minneapolis, delivers evidence-based health plan management and medical knowledge solutions to managed care and indemnity marketplaces nationwide. |
